The Tree Removal Process: What to Expect

There are plenty of reasons a tree may need to come down, from storm damage, disease, and safety concerns, but one thing’s for sure: it should be done by pros.

At Woodland Tree Service, we make the process clear, safe, and as stress-free as possible.

1. Initial Consultation and Site Assessment

A safe, successful tree removal starts with understanding your property. Our arborists take time to assess everything from the tree’s stability to the layout of your yard.

2. Detailed Estimate and Scheduling

You’ll never be left guessing about what comes next. We provide a transparent estimate and coordinate a time that makes sense for both your schedule and the conditions outside.

3. Safety Preparation and Equipment Setup

Before the first cut, our crew sets the stage for a safe, smooth process. From placing cones and signs to setting up rigging and protecting your yard, we handle the prep with care.

4. Strategic Limb and Section Removal

Tree removal starts from the top down. Limbs are cut and lowered one by one using rigging systems to prevent property damage. This method is especially useful for trees near homes, fences, or power lines, a level of care that sets Woodland apart from less experienced providers.

5. Trunk Sectioning and Base Removal

With the canopy cleared, we carefully take the trunk down piece by piece. Our crew uses professional-grade tools and cranes, if needed, to lower each section safely and avoid damage to your property.

6. Cleanup and Debris Hauling

Once the tree’s down, we shift into cleanup mode. Our crew gathers every branch and stump piece, giving you the option to keep firewood or leave with a spotless yard.

7. Final Walkthrough and Safety Check

We finish every job with care. A full safety sweep and one last check help us leave your property just the way we’d want ours: clean, safe, and job done right.

Are certain tree species in my area more prone to disease or damage?

Yes. In Eden Prairie, species like ash and elm are particularly vulnerable to pests and diseases such as emerald ash borer and Dutch elm disease. Regular inspections and timely pruning can help reduce these risks.

What’s the process for large-scale lot clearing for commercial tree services and land development?

Our lot clearing team takes a strategic approach: evaluate, remove, and clean up. We figure out which trees should stay, clear what’s needed with powerful equipment, and make sure everything’s ready for builders to get started on your commercial tree project.

What’s the best time of year to trim hardwood vs. evergreen trees in Minnesota?

Hardwoods are best for late winter, before spring growth. Evergreens are ideal for light summer trims once the new branches mature. Right timing means better long-term results.

How deep does a stump need to be ground for full removal?

Standard depth is 6–12 inches below grade, perfect for stopping regrowth and making space for new grass or plantings. Deeper grinds are always an option if needed.
